1,1,3,3-Tetramethyldisiloxane: A Green Catalyst Component for Enhanced Synthesis
In the pursuit of more sustainable and efficient chemical synthesis, the role of auxiliary reagents that enhance catalytic activity and selectivity is increasingly vital. 1,1,3,3-Tetramethyldisiloxane (TMDSO), a readily available organosilicon compound, serves an important function as a hydrogen donor in numerous catalytic reactions. TMDSO's molecular structure, featuring two Si-H bonds, makes it an excellent source of hydrogen atoms in catalytic hydrogenation and reduction reactions. When used in conjunction with transition metal catalysts – such as platinum, palladium, rhodium, or iridium complexes – TMDSO facilitates the transfer of hydrogen to unsaturated substrates. This mechanism is particularly effective for reactions where direct hydrogenation using gaseous hydrogen might be challenging or less selective.
The advantages of using TMDSO as a hydrogen donor are manifold. Firstly, it often leads to higher selectivity compared to other reducing agents. This is crucial for complex molecules where targeting specific functional groups is essential. For instance, in the synthesis of pharmaceutical intermediates, the precise reduction of a carbonyl to an alcohol without affecting other parts of the molecule is critical. Secondly, TMDSO offers significant environmental benefits. Its byproducts are typically silicon oxides or volatile silicon-containing species, which are generally considered less harmful and easier to handle and dispose of than waste streams from many metal hydride reducing agents. This makes it a preferred choice for implementing greener chemical methodologies, a growing priority for chemical industries worldwide. Moreover, TMDSO's utility extends to migration hydrogenation, where it can effectively transfer hydrogen atoms to facilitate isomerization or reduction processes. Its mild reaction conditions further add to its appeal, making it suitable for sensitive substrates that might degrade under harsher treatments. This versatility allows chemists to expand the scope of catalytic transformations they can perform.
